Special hazards work is where fire protection stops being “one size fits all” and becomes a true design challenge. This role is for someone who likes high-stakes environments, complex systems, and getting the details right, because the environments you are designing do not leave room for guesswork.
As a Special Hazards Fire Protection Designer at Encore, you will design specialized suppression systems for high-risk settings like data centers, industrial facilities, power plants, and aircraft hangars. You will partner closely with project teams to produce designs that are code-compliant, technically sound, and practical to install, while helping Encore deliver the kind of service quality that keeps customers safe and confident.
You will be the person who turns risk, code, and engineering reality into a design a team can build from. Your work will include:
Design and layout special hazards fire suppression systems, including but not limited to clean agent systems (for example FM-200, Novec 1230), CO₂ systems, foam suppression systems, water mist systems, and explosion suppression or detection systems.
Prepare detailed CAD drawings and system schematics.
Perform hydraulic calculations and flow analysis to verify system performance.
Ensure design compliance with NFPA codes (for example NFPA 2001, 12, 750), local requirements, and client specifications.
Coordinate with architects, engineers, and contractors to integrate fire protection systems into building plans.
Review submittals and technical specifications for accuracy and completeness.
Assist in developing bills of materials and scope documentation for estimating and procurement.
Provide technical support during installation, commissioning, and inspection phases.
Three to five years of experience designing fire protection systems, with a focus on special hazards
Hands-on experience with AutoCAD or another CAD platform and Revit; if you have used a different design tool and are comfortable learning new software, we can help you ramp up on AutoCAD
Working knowledge of NFPA 72, IBC, and relevant local fire codes, or a strong willingness to learn and apply these standards
Proficiency with Microsoft Office tools such as Word and Excel, and the ability to learn new software tools as needed
Strong organ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ple projects and deadlines at the same time
Solid problem-solving skills and attention to detail, with a focus on accuracy and quality from start to finish
Clear written and verbal communication skills and the ability to work effectively with both technical and non-technical stakeholders
Self-motivated, punctual, and reliable, with the ability to work independently and as part of a team
A valid driver's license and reliable transportation for site visits and meetings
What Will Make You Stand Out?
You have a bachelor's degree or associate degree in Engineering, Fire Protection, Mechanical Design, or related field.
You have a NICET Level II (or higher) in Special Hazards Systems or Fire Protection Engineering Technology.
You have experience designing for complex, high-risk environments (for example data centers, industrial, power generation, hangars).
You have experience coordinating directly with authorities having jurisdiction on fire alarm designs and submittals.
